Great Alternative Phone
Pros
Great battery life. Compared to my old S8+ it's night and day different.
Snappy interface. It's got 2gb more RAM than my S8+ can't tell a huge difference but it's good.
Good display. This is only seen if you have this up to a flagship phone side by side. There is a difference but by itself it's just fine.
Non-curved screen. Never was a fan of curved screen on flagship phones.
Great price. I've had several phones from cheap to flagship to middle of the road. This the best bang for your buck.
Cons
Finger print scanner on screen can be a little cumbersome compared to the S8+ that had it on the back.
Overall I'd have to say this one of the best phones I've ever purchased. I think for the last 7 to 10 years the specs get crazy for flagship phones and if you don't need all those features you need a cheaper alternative. I'll buy used or open box flagship phones but those are still pretty pricey. If you are a casual user like me this is the phone for you. Hands down the best bang for your buck if you don't want to spend a thousand dollars on a flagship phone. This is mainly because I'm not tied to a carrier and I've always bought my phones outright. To each their own but for me I'll buy something with the same specs as a two year old flagship phone but it a new body. Just makes sense.

Great product, hard to install
I guess the product shouldn't get a bad review when all the negative feelings I have towards this product have to do with the phone. I've used tempered glass screen protectors on my phones for years and that is the best product in my opinion for protection if you want to keep it not so bulky. Most tempered glass is easy to put on. With the S8 plus' curved edges it makes it very difficult to get all the bubbles out. I like that it's full coverage and that it's full adhesive. I've only owned this phone for about a month and have tried the outside edge adhesive glasses and they are okay but not the best. This glass works fine and installation I would give it a 3 star. I had several bubbles and it took a while to get them all worked out. It's still a great product and works great to protect your phone just a pain to install.

Awesome little toy
As a kid I loved remote control cars. I owned several and broke them all:) I bought this for my 7 year old and he loves it. After getting used to the controls we've gotten a little more risky on trying to land it on certain things in the living room. Its taking several spills/crashes but hasn't seemed to hurt anything. It charges in 30 to 40 minutes and will fly for about 5 mins maybe a little more. But in that 5 minutes it's a great experience and worth every bit if not more than the 18+ dollars we spent on it. I'm looking at buying one for my self and getting the bigger battery for it. I would caution I do have a 3 (almost 4) year old and so far I haven't had any trouble with him getting a hold of it and I wouldn't think that it would hurt any one that bad if it hit them but I think about it hitting around the face and eyes or even getting caught in a girls hair. It's small but it has the power to be dangerous and it's much easier to fly in a big open area with vaulted ceilings like our main living area. If it was in smaller room or with younger than 3 year olds around I would worry a lot more about someone getting hurt. Use caution. Haven't taken it outside and don't plan to per instructions it's probably more fun inside anyway.
